Two hypothesis clarify the issue of rising CO2 that is usually encountered when furnishing oxygen therapy in COPD. The 1st speculation relates to respiratory generate. Greater CO2 degrees in the blood give induce the brain to mail the signal on the pulmonary process for breathing. With time, COPD patients may begin to keep CO2 and in a few patients, this increasing degree blunts the brain’s CO2 reaction – the brain effectively learns to tolerate increased CO2. As a single writer puts it, the brain responds to this problem by adopting a policy of “‘can’t breathe, so gained’t breathe,” or “say-uncle.” three The brain then shifts to your back-up bring about for respiration – specifically lowering blood oxygen ranges. If too much supplemental oxygen click here is supplied to the patients who will be counting on blood O2 to set off breathing, the necessity to breath is minimized resulting in significant amounts of CO2.
